This is the first record of a mixed flora, including angiospermous leaf impressions, from the Lower Cretaceous (Upper Aptian-Lower Albian) of south Tunisia. Two localities, which are described here, Bir el Karma and Foum el Hassen, have similar floras, with ferns, conifers and fragmentary angiosperm leaves. The presence of these fossils is discussed, particularly those with angiospermous affinities. (C) 2001 Academic Press.
